395 impl AuthService for MemoryAuthService {
396 async fn login(&self, credentials: &Credentials) -> AuthResult<AuthToken> {
397 let mut users = self.users.write().await;
398
399 let user = users
400 .values_mut()
401 .find(|u| u.info.username == credentials.identifier || u.info.email.as_deref() == Some(&credentials.identifier))
402 .ok_or(WaeError::invalid_credentials())?;
403
404 if user.locked_until.map(|t| t > Self::current_timestamp()).unwrap_or(false) {
405 return Err(WaeError::account_locked());
406 }
407
408 if !self.verify_password(&credentials.password, &user.password_hash)? {
409 user.login_attempts += 1;
410 if user.login_attempts >= self.config.max_login_attempts {
411 user.locked_until = Some(Self::current_timestamp() + self.config.lockout_duration as i64);
412 return Err(WaeError::account_locked());
413 }
414 return Err(WaeError::invalid_credentials());
415 }
416
417 user.login_attempts = 0;
418 user.locked_until = None;
419
420 let access_token = Self::generate_token();
421 let refresh_token = Self::generate_token();
422 let now = Self::current_timestamp();
423
424 self.tokens
425 .write()
426 .await
427 .insert(access_token.clone(), (user.info.id.clone(), now + self.config.token_expires_in as i64));
428 self.refresh_tokens
429 .write()
430 .await
431 .insert(refresh_token.clone(), (user.info.id.clone(), now + self.config.refresh_token_expires_in as i64));
432
433 Ok(AuthToken {
434 access_token,
435 refresh_token: Some(refresh_token),
436 token_type: "Bearer".to_string(),
437 expires_in: self.config.token_expires_in,
438 expires_at: now + self.config.token_expires_in as i64,
439 })
440 }
